Kolkata, March 3 (NationPress) The undefeated South Africa team is set to go head-to-head with New Zealand in the opening semi-final of the ongoing T20 World Cup 2026, which will take place at Eden Gardens on Wednesday.
The Proteas are arriving at this match after a stellar performance in the Super 8s, where they first triumphed over the defending champions, India, by a significant margin of 76 runs. Under the leadership of Aiden Markram, they claimed their second victory by defeating the two-time champions, West Indies, by nine wickets. They concluded their Super 8s journey with a nail-biting victory against Zimbabwe.
In contrast, New Zealand had a somewhat inconsistent Super 8s phase, as their opening match against Pakistan was interrupted by rain. However, they bounced back strongly in their next game, overpowering Sri Lanka with a commanding 61-run win. Unfortunately, the team, led by Mitchell Santner, faced a narrow defeat against England in their final encounter. Despite finishing with 3 points, they advanced to the next stage thanks to a solid net run rate (NRR).
This clash marks the sixth occasion that these two teams will meet in a T20 World Cup setting. Historically, South Africa has maintained a strong upper hand against New Zealand, as the Blackcaps have yet to secure a victory against them in any World Cup.
Their first encounter was during the 2007 World Cup quarter-finals, where the home team, South Africa, emerged victorious by 6 wickets.
In their second meeting, the match turned into a nail-biter, with South Africa clinching victory by just one run during the T20 World Cup in 2009.
The two teams faced off again in the 2010 World Cup, where the Proteas won by 13 runs in Birmingham.
In 2014, New Zealand faced their fourth defeat against South Africa in World Cup history, losing by a mere two runs.
The most recent showdown took place in the group stage of the current World Cup, where Aiden Markram and his team secured a 7-wicket win in Ahmedabad.
